Book Synopsis



Entrepreneur and activist Collette Divitto follows up her debut children's book, Collette in Kindergarten, with the heartwarming second installment, Collette in Third Grade.


With a new year comes new challenges. Collette, a young girl with Down syndrome, must navigate balancing her busy schedule and a difficult curriculum, all while feeling different from her classmates. Join Collette during her third-grade year, and meet the special person who helps her along the way.
